A review of the Panasonic Lumix DMC-LZ5 digital camera is available at PCMag.
The Panasonic Lumix DMC-LZ5 features 6 megapixels resolution and a 6x optical zoom. The DMC-LZ5 uses Panasonic’s optical image stabilizer, which combined with the LZ5’s high ISO sensitivity enables you to capture fast moving objects or shoot in low light conditions, while minimizing picture blur.
The editors gave the Panasonic DMC-LZ5 3 out of 5 points.
The review conclusion:
“If you’re looking for a digital camera with 6X optical zoom, you’ll be hard-pressed to find a better camera at a cheaper price. Nonetheless, the Lumix DMC-LZ5’s performance issues keep it out of the running for an Editors’ Choice award.”
